Historical context: a decade of energy evolution

Over the past decade, the United States transformed from a net importer of crude to a leading energy exporter, driven by a combination of shale oil production, expanded natural gas production, and investments in refining capacity. This transition altered the balance of power within energy markets and created new benchmarks for reliability and pricing. The current surge in exports follows a string of developments: sustained output growth from domestic shale plays, improvements in LNG liquefaction and export infrastructure, and strategic policy choices that encouraged hitherto constrained flows to international markets. While the specifics of any single geopolitical event can drive short-term volatility, the broader trend reflects a long-running shift toward greater U.S. energy self‑reliance and influence.

Immediate momentum in crude and refined products

Recent weekly data indicate crude exports reaching levels not seen before, with shipments averaging around 5.2 million barrels per day. This marks a notable expansion in the United States’ role as a reliable supplier to global markets, particularly for customers seeking to diversify their crude baskets amid geopolitical tensions. The expansion was complemented by a robust refining sector that continues to produce a broad mix of fuels for export or domestic use, including diesel, gasoline, and jet fuel. In parallel, the U.S. refining system has benefited from investments that support higher throughput and more flexible processing configurations, enabling refiners to adapt to shifting demand patterns and international requirements.

LNG markets and long-term contracts in Asia

The global liquefied natural gas market is undergoing a structural shift as Asia, in particular, seeks stable, long-term LNG agreements to secure power generation and industrial feedstock. U.S. LNG exports have risen in response to sustained demand from Asian buyers and the availability of liquefaction capacity in North American terminals. The allure of U.S. LNG lies in its reliability, compliance with modern safety standards, and the flexibility offered by gas-linked contracts that can be adjusted in response to market conditions. Asian purchasers seeking predictable energy costs in a period of volatility are increasingly integrating U.S. LNG into their energy portfolios, negotiating terms that reflect both price transparency and long-term security of supply.

Economic impact: markets, prices, and investment signals

The reallocation of energy flows has multiple economic repercussions. First, energy prices respond to the new price discovery dynamics created by a larger U.S. export presence. Crude differentials, refinery margins, and LNG pricing structures can shift as buyers reassess trade routes and counterparties. Second, the expansion of U.S. energy exposure attracts investment in infrastructure, including ports, pipelines, and storage facilities, as domestic producers and refiners position themselves to serve international markets more efficiently. Third, consumer energy costs—while still subject to global cycles—may experience different pressure points as freight, shipping, and feedstock costs respond to higher export activity and the integration of international markets.

Operational and logistical considerations

The trajectory of higher U.S. energy exports depends on a complex mix of factors:

  • Infrastructure readiness: Terminal capacity, storage, and export logistics must keep pace with rising volumes to avoid bottlenecks that could erase the benefits of increased production.
  • Regulatory alignment: Export approvals, environmental standards, and cross-border agreements shape how quickly changes in supply can translate into real-world movements.
  • Market discipline: The ability of buyers to integrate U.S. energy into existing portfolios depends on the availability of hedging tools, transparent pricing, and reliable contractual terms that mitigate counterparty risk.
  • Geopolitical risk: While energy supply diversification provides resilience, geopolitical tensions can still introduce volatility. Traders and policymakers must monitor developments that could abruptly alter flows or pricing dynamics.
